Propeller Ceiling Effect in Forward Flight
Journal of AircraftThe study extends the investigation of the fixed-pitch small-scale propeller in the ceiling effect to forward flight conditions at different propeller incidence angles. Force-based experiments, phase-locked particle image velocimetry (PIV), and surface oil flow visualization were conducted on two APC propellers at the University of Dayton Low Speed ...

Symmetry breaking leads to forward flapping flight
Journal of Fluid Mechanics, 2004Flapping flight is ubiquitous in Nature, yet cilia and flagella, not wings, prevail in the world of micro-organisms. This paper addresses this dichotomy. We investigate experimentally the dynamics of a wing, flapped up and down and free to move horizontally.

Boundary-layer separation on rotating blades in forward flight.
AIAA Journal, 1972A study has been made to determine the effects of rotation, forward flight, angle of attack, lift and downflow on the laminar boundary-layer separation on an idealized rigid blade of infinite extent. As a result of the method of analysis it is possible to isolate the effects of angle of attack, forward flight and downflow velocity.

Forward flight of swallowtail butterfly with simple flapping motion
Bioinspiration & Biomimetics, 2010Unlike other flying insects, the wing motion of swallowtail butterflies is basically limited to flapping because their fore wings partly overlap their hind wings, structurally restricting the feathering needed for active control of aerodynamic force.

Laminar boundary layers on helicopter rotors in forward flight.
AIAA Journal, 1968Several examples of three-dimensi onal boundary layers on helicopter rotors in forward flight are analyzed within the framework of small-crossflow and quasi-steady approximations; these two assumptions are shown to be mutually consistent and to have a wide range of applicability.

Compound helicopter load alleviation in forward flight
2021The potential benefits of using redundant controls on a compound helicopter for manoeuvre load alleviation whilst optimizing handling qualities are investigated. The research is focused on forward flight lateral (roll) manoeuvres and hub loads. The main control effectors of interest are the ailerons and lateral cyclic pitch.

Flight Dynamics Modeling and System Identification of a Cyclocopter in Forward Flight
Proceedings of the Vertical Flight Society 71st Annual Forum, 2015This paper describes the system identification methodology and the identified flight dynamics model of a cyclocopter micro air vehicle (MAV) in forward flight. The cyclocoper utilizes two cycloidal rotors (cyclorotors), a novel horizontal-axis propulsion system with rotating wings.

SOUND RADIATION FROM PROPELLERS IN FORWARD FLIGHT
Journal of Sound and Vibration, 1999Abstract A method is presented for the exact numerical integration of acoustic radiation integrals for a disc-shaped source in a mean flow. The technique allows the calculation of a harmonic of the acoustic field around the source and the study of its variation with the parameters relevant to aircraft propeller noise.
